Sec. 1111A.022. LIFE SETTLEMENT ANTIFRAUD INITIATIVES.

(a)A provider or broker shall implement antifraud initiatives reasonably calculated to detect, prosecute, and prevent fraudulent life settlement acts. At the discretion of the commissioner, the commissioner may order, or a license holder may request and the commissioner may grant, a modification of the following required initiatives as necessary to ensure an effective antifraud program. A modification granted under this section may be more or less restrictive than the required initiatives so long as the modification may reasonably be expected to accomplish the purpose of this section. Antifraud initiatives must include:
(1)fraud investigators, who may be provider or broker employees or independent contractors; and
